Context: Turning Apologies into Play

Apologizing can feel awkward, especially for younger learners or those who struggle with phrasing. A printable game board transforms the act of saying sorry into a low‑pressure activity, letting participants rehearse polite expressions in a playful setting. By turning the apology into a move on a board, the experience becomes memorable and repeatable, supporting language development without the stress of a real‑life confrontation.

Details: Game Board Design and Rules

The board features a colorful path with spaces that prompt specific apology scenarios, such as “Offer a compliment” or “Explain the mistake.” Each space includes a short prompt that guides the player toward a clear, style‑appropriate apology. Rules are straightforward: roll a die, move the token, and respond with the suggested phrasing. Success is marked by a check‑off, encouraging repeated practice and confidence building.

Implications: Practical Benefits for Learners

Using the printable Sorry game provides several tangible benefits. It offers a structured yet flexible framework that can be adapted for classroom lessons, family game night, or individual practice. The visual layout helps learners associate specific words with actions, reinforcing correct grammar and tone. Moreover, the game’s portable format allows educators to integrate it into language curricula without needing extensive preparation.

Because the template is free to download and print, it removes cost barriers, making it accessible to a wide audience. Teachers can customize the prompts to align with current lesson objectives, while parents can use it to model polite communication during everyday situations. The result is a practical tool that supports social‑emotional learning and language proficiency simultaneously.
